Paper
30 July 2002 Core mapping application programming interface (CMAPI)
Michael J. Mayhew, Doug J. Barnum, Stephen W. Barth
Author Affiliations +
Abstract
Geographic data elements are an essential part of any intelligence information system. Visualization of this data on map displays is indispensable in supporting data analysis for mission objectives. No matter what the application domain, (DoD/State Government/e-commerce) the display of information on a geographic map is no longer a "nice-to-have" feature; it's now a mandatory one. The need for data visualization with map graphics has created an abundant supply of mapping products. The capabilities of these products range from advanced Geographic Information Systems (GIS) to basic products for map graphics presentation. The Core Mapping Application Programming Interface, CMAPI, provides a standardized interface to commercial and government off-the-shelf map engines. Using CMAPI allows application developers and their customers to avoid being locked into a specific vendor. As a result, sites where applications are deployed can avoid having to license multiple products that perform the same function. CMAPI is designed and implemented using software component technology for "plug and play" map engine compatibility. CMAPI front-end software components are easy to integrate with web-based thin-client and multi-platform thick client applications. CMAPI back-end components provide implementation of core mapping functionality using any one of several off-the-shelf map engines. In addition, CMAPI provides an XML import and export capability that allows applications to share map data while using different map engines.
© (2002) COPYRIGHT Society of Photo-Optical Instrumentation Engineers (SPIE). Downloading of the abstract is permitted for personal use only.
Michael J. Mayhew, Doug J. Barnum, and Stephen W. Barth "Core mapping application programming interface (CMAPI)", Proc. SPIE 4744, Radar Sensor Technology and Data Visualization, (30 July 2002); https://doi.org/10.1117/12.488295
Advertisement
Advertisement
RIGHTS & PERMISSIONS
Get copyright permission  Get copyright permission on Copyright Marketplace
KEYWORDS
Visualization

Geographic information systems

Associative arrays

Human-machine interfaces

Computer programming

Software development

Data visualization

RELATED CONTENT

Plot of plots and selection glass
Proceedings of SPIE (January 16 2006)
Keywords revisited
Proceedings of SPIE (November 27 2002)
Geoscience visualization with GPU programming
Proceedings of SPIE (March 11 2005)

Back to Top